 "NORTH," the acclaimed new album from Emblem/Atlantic recording group Matchbox Twenty, has made a stunning chart debut, coming in at #1 on the SoundScan/Billboard 200 after its first week in release. Fueled by critical acclaim -- as well as the current hit single, "She's So Mean" -- the album's unprecedented popularity marks the multi-platinum rock band's first-ever chart-topper and #1 debut. "To be a band that put out our first album in 1996, and have our first #1 in 2012 feels like we are doing something right," said Matchbox Twenty frontman Rob Thomas.

Matchbox Twenty will celebrate with an upcoming live appearance on the nationally syndicated Ellen Degeneres Show, slated for Tuesday, October 2nd. In addition, the band's Rob Thomas and Kyle Cook can be seen on the September 15th edition of VH1's Top 20 Countdown. (check local listings). The appearances follow a long string of high profile TV performances heralding "NORTH," including NBC's TODAY, CBS' Late Show with David Letterman, and VH1's Big Morning Buzz Live, not to mention frontman Thomas' visit to CNN's Piers Morgan Tonight.

In addition to its chart-topping success here in the United States, "NORTH" has further proven an international sensation by also entering the Australian album chart at #1. Matchbox Twenty will thank their many fans down under with a hugely anticipated Australian arena tour, kicking off October 20th at Melbourne's Rod Laver Arena. The trek follows two upcoming sold out London headline shows, O2 Shepherds Bush Empire on September 18th and the upcoming iTunes Festival 2012, slated for September 19th at Camden's famed Roundhouse.
